How We Handle Asphalt Repair in Garden Grove

Asphalt repair means we fix the damage on your existing asphalt surfaces. This includes filling cracks, patching potholes, and addressing areas that are crumbling or sinking. We don't just cover it up; we get to the root of the problem to make sure the repair holds.

Our approach starts with checking out the damage thoroughly. We figure out why it happened – maybe it's water getting under the surface, heavy traffic, or just old age. Knowing the cause helps us pick the right repair method, whether it's a simple crack fill or a more involved cut-and-patch job.

For Garden Grove properties, dealing with asphalt damage quickly is smart. Our local climate, with its hot summers and occasional heavy rains, can make small cracks turn into big potholes fast. Water seeps in, freezes (rarely, but it happens) or expands with heat, and breaks down the base. We see it all the time here.

Why is Asphalt Repair Important for Your Garden Grove Property?

Asphalt repair is important because it stops small problems from becoming huge, expensive ones. A small crack lets water under your driveway, which then erodes the base layer. Once that base is gone, you get potholes and major structural failures. Fixing it early saves you a full replacement down the road.

In Garden Grove, our soil conditions can be a factor. We've got a mix, and sometimes shifting ground or poor drainage can stress asphalt. Plus, the sun here bakes surfaces, making them brittle over time. Regular repair keeps the surface sealed and flexible, ready to handle the local weather.

Beyond just saving money, good asphalt repair keeps your property safe and looking good. Potholes are tripping hazards for people and can damage vehicle tires and suspensions. Our Asphalt Repair Process

1

Initial Assessment

We come out to your Garden Grove property to inspect the damage. We identify the type of damage, its cause, and the best repair method.

2

Surface Preparation

We clean the area thoroughly, removing loose debris, dirt, and vegetation. For potholes, we cut out the damaged section to create clean edges.

3

Material Application

Depending on the repair, we apply crack filler, hot asphalt mix, or other specialized materials. We make sure the new material bonds properly with the existing asphalt.

4

Compaction & Finish

We compact the repaired area to ensure it's dense and level with the surrounding surface. This creates a strong, durable patch that will stand up to traffic and weather.

A quality asphalt repair in Garden Grove typically lasts anywhere from 3 to 7 years, depending on the type of repair, traffic volume, and how well the area is maintained afterward. Crack fills usually need reapplication sooner than a full cut-and-patch repair. Proper drainage and regular sealcoating can extend the life of any repair significantly, especially with our sunny climate.
Yes, we can repair most sizes of potholes and cracks, from small hairline cracks to large, deep potholes. For very extensive damage, especially if it covers a large percentage of the surface, a full resurfacing or replacement might be a more cost-effective and durable solution than multiple small repairs. We'll assess the damage and recommend the best option for your Garden Grove property.
You can typically drive on a repaired asphalt surface within 24 to 48 hours after the work is completed. This allows the new asphalt material to cool and cure properly, ensuring maximum durability and preventing premature damage.
